Hey — handing off Sproutly before I'm out next week. The watering scheduler is feature-complete for this release; only open item is the timezone edge case around the midnight run, which has a workaround in place. Nothing blocking the cut. Full status, open tickets, and rollout notes are on the page below.

wiki page, bajog-tahop: https://confluence.qorvelsys.internal/browse/pages/pages/pages

Handover note — Q3 stock-count ledger

Passing the Wrenfield Q3 stock-count ledger to the records team today. All pages initialled, discrepancies flagged with green tabs. It goes by courier to the Caldmore archive this afternoon in the locked canvas satchel. The courier collecting it must follow the hand-over instruction below.

handover note for yagef-bagep: the drudor pelius courier leaves the kasdor zorvan norir ledger at gate 8016 under passcode 755406

Q: Why do Thimbleframe handlers sometimes take 4+ seconds on first invocation?

A: Cold starts. The runtime provisions a fresh sandbox and loads the dependency bundle. Mitigations: keep bundles under 10 MB, enable the warm-pool flag for latency-sensitive routes, and avoid init-time network calls. Benchmarks and tuning guidance are on the internal page below.

runbook for badug-kadup: https://confluence.zemvarlabs.internal/projects/browse/display/projects/bd1b

### Step 4: Migrate the tide-table widget

The Moonreach tide widget now pulls predictions from the Saltmark API instead of the bundled dataset. For the eng sync: this removes the 18 MB static table and adds a five-minute cache. Update embeds to the v2 snippet and remove the old data file from builds. Once embedded, point the widget at the settings shown below.

service settings:
[silwyn]
host = silwyn.crelvogrid.internal
user = silwyn_svc
database = silwyn_prod

Ticket #4471 — Fleet fuel-usage report failing. The nightly FuelSight export for the Dray-Line vans stopped running because the service credentials expired last Friday. Reports for the Harwick depot are stale as a result. A fresh key has been issued by the platform team; rotate it into the scheduler config before the next run. Use the key below.

gateway credential: kto7_GoY89Me